Rostonn Brutus, Bachelor of Law. Postgraduate degree in Financial Administration/Economics. Illinois State University (ISU)/Management Development Institute (MDI). Commercial Director of Presses Nationales d'Haïti. Inspector of Finance. Auditor of Public Administration and Finance, Ministry of Economy and Finance.
This work is of scientific interest. This subject would contribute to launching the debate on the alternative means offered by the international human rights system for a better action of the State in the search for the protection of its citizens. In this sense, society today is reproving certain acts that tend to upset it. This disapproval is even greater when these acts, committed by political figures or their supporters, have gone unpunished. The research work also takes into account immunity, an institution established by the constitution and created to guarantee the legal independence of parliamentarians and to protect them from intimidation by political power. The general objective of this work is to show the causes and consequences of certain legal factors and other institutional facts with regard to the fight against impunity in the face of international mechanisms and the role of the state.
